🥩 Meat & wine – the perfect combination for connoisseurs
Meat dishes and wine – a timeless combination that offers a wide range of possibilities depending on the preparation, spices and texture. But not every wine goes well with every meat. While a strong Cabernet Sauvignon harmonises perfectly with a juicy steak, an elegant Pinot Noir is the ideal complement to tender veal or poultry.
The right choice depends on Meat type, cooking technique and sauce from. A braised lamb dish calls for a different wine than a tender veal escalope or a hearty game ragout. Here you will find a detailed overview of which wines go best with the different types of meat:
